What is stingy?

In the dictionary, a stingy person is one who doesn't like to share what is theirs, is attached to money, and overvalues the desire for material possessions, all in a way that affects their own leisure and comfort, or even hinders greater achievements.

The word stingy behavior is quite delicate for those who share their financial situation with others, for example. In view of this, the word is not used as a good quality, since it usually damages interpersonal relationships.

Another term with a very similar definition is avarice. Known as one of the seven deadly sins, avarice consists in excessively cherishing the accumulation of money and wealth, even if this requires sacrifices by oneself and others.

This characteristic can cause family disagreements, impasses in love relationships, and make it difficult to build solid and lasting relationships. However, it is worth pointing out that stinginess does not determine whether an individual is a failure or a success.

Meaning of stingy

Knowing the meaning of stingy makes it easier to understand the different contexts in which the word can be used, that is, even though it is a pejorative reference, it can be used to describe everything from the leader of a large company to the most junior employee.

In the first case mentioned, the meaning of the word represents a lifestyle of the individual who has good financial conditions. But even with money, he chooses to live a very limited life, containing expenses in an exaggerated way.

Moreover, the stingy person who has a high rank tends to be unfair to employees and contractors. This is done, for example, by denying raises or benefits to the category that socially depends much more on paid work.

On the other hand, A person without resources who is stingy tends to be confused with the thrifty. Both are quite different things, so it is important to know how to differentiate between each of these behaviors.

Beforehand, the thrifty person does not give up physical well-being and basic needs just to save money. Thus, there is a balance between saving and investing in one's own security and satisfaction.

Stingy behavior

Petty-mindedness develops a particular behavior that can popularly be called "cowhand", "hard bread", among other expressions. Regardless of how the adjective is known in each region, the behavior is the same.

This type of person believes that he/she maintains economical habits, when in fact he/she is always looking for an accumulation of values in his/her account that will never be reached. This is because no amount of money will ever be enough to satisfy the stingy person.

This is not the case for the thrifty person, who cuts expenses for a concrete objective, with defined values and deadlines. If when the person achieves what he or she has planned, he or she allows themselves to be flexible with their savings, their leisure is being prioritized.

In other words, money is not a priority, but your satisfactions and achievements together. Therefore, this is an economical behavior, since it values everyone's real well-being.

The stingy person, on the other hand, is much more focused on his personal interests. He cares little about the achievement of others and is inclined to exploit the generosity and favors they offer him.

Habits of a stingy person

In practice, to know if you or someone around you has stingy habits is not at all difficult. This is because the characteristics are very standardized and easily identifiable with little time spent together.

And the main and most common habits are:

Claiming unfair discounts

It doesn't matter if the seller's profit is low or if the price is already compatible with the product. The person will always ask for a further discount and even give up the purchase - even if he has enough money - if he doesn't get the requested reduction in value.

Cheating on deals

One of the most striking characteristics of stinginess is cheating. These types of people always find a way to take advantage in their deals and gain something at the expense of the other person - even more so without the other person's knowledge.

Pretending not to have enough money

Another very common habit is to play the poor and appear to have no money to pay for your expenses. This includes everything from lunch in a restaurant to the basics of household expenses. The person always appeals for someone to help him with the bills.

Holding debt unnecessarily

Since this person doesn't like to spend money, even if he or she can pay in cash, he or she will always be paying in installments, and even accumulating installments. In this way, he or she can never get out of debt and ends up owing unnecessarily high amounts.

Always act out of self-interest

The stingy person doesn't care much about the interests of his or her partner or family members, nor about the growth of the people who provide him or her with some service. What matters to him or her is that his or her own interests are served.

It is because of these habits and behaviors that it becomes difficult to live with someone who is stingy. After all, this individual will be depriving himself and others of enjoying life at leisure, and harming others around him at the same time.
